- pyquil.gates.CCNOT(control1: Union[pyquil.quilatom.Qubit, pyquil.quilatom.QubitPlaceholder, pyquil.quilatom.FormalArgument, int], control2: Union[pyquil.quilatom.Qubit, pyquil.quilatom.QubitPlaceholder, pyquil.quilatom.FormalArgument, int], target: Union[pyquil.quilatom.Qubit, pyquil.quilatom.QubitPlaceholder, pyquil.quilatom.FormalArgument, int]) pyquil.quilbase.Gate [source]¶
Produces a doubly-controlled NOT gate:
CCNOT = [[1,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0], [0, 1,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0], [0, 0, 1,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0], [0, 0, 0, 1, 0, 0, 0, 0], [0, 0, 0, 0, 1, 0, 0, 0], [0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 1, 0, 0], [0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 1], [0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 1, 0]]
This gate applies to three qubit arguments to produce the controlled-controlled-not gate instruction.
- Parameters
control1 – The first control qubit.
control2 – The second control qubit.
target – The target qubit. The target qubit has an X-gate applied to it if both control qubits are in the excited state.
- Returns
A Gate object.
- pyquil.gates.CNOT(control: Union[pyquil.quilatom.Qubit, pyquil.quilatom.QubitPlaceholder, pyquil.quilatom.FormalArgument, int], target: Union[pyquil.quilatom.Qubit, pyquil.quilatom.QubitPlaceholder, pyquil.quilatom.FormalArgument, int]) pyquil.quilbase.Gate [source]¶
Produces a controlled-NOT (controlled-X) gate:
CNOT = [[1, 0, 0, 0], [0, 1, 0, 0], [0, 0, 0, 1], [0, 0, 1, 0]]
This gate applies to two qubit arguments to produce the controlled-not gate instruction.
- Parameters
control – The control qubit.
target – The target qubit. The target qubit has an X-gate applied to it if the control qubit is in the
|1>
state.
- Returns
A Gate object.

- pyquil.gates.CPHASE(angle: Union[pyquil.quilatom.Expression, pyquil.quilatom.MemoryReference, numpy.int64, int, float, complex], control: Union[pyquil.quilatom.Qubit, pyquil.quilatom.QubitPlaceholder, pyquil.quilatom.FormalArgument, int], target: Union[pyquil.quilatom.Qubit, pyquil.quilatom.QubitPlaceholder, pyquil.quilatom.FormalArgument, int]) pyquil.quilbase.Gate [source]¶
Produces a controlled-phase instruction:
CPHASE(phi) = diag([1, 1, 1, exp(1j * phi)])
This gate applies to two qubit arguments to produce the variant of the controlled phase instruction that affects the state 11.
Compare with the
CPHASExx
variants. This variant is the most common and does not have a suffix, although you can think of it asCPHASE11
.- Parameters
angle – The input phase angle to apply when both qubits are in the
|1>
state.control – Qubit 1.
target – Qubit 2.
- Returns
A Gate object.

- pyquil.gates.CSWAP(control: Union[pyquil.quilatom.Qubit, pyquil.quilatom.QubitPlaceholder, pyquil.quilatom.FormalArgument, int], target_1: Union[pyquil.quilatom.Qubit, pyquil.quilatom.QubitPlaceholder, pyquil.quilatom.FormalArgument, int], target_2: Union[pyquil.quilatom.Qubit, pyquil.quilatom.QubitPlaceholder, pyquil.quilatom.FormalArgument, int]) pyquil.quilbase.Gate [source]¶
Produces a controlled-SWAP gate. This gate conditionally swaps the state of two qubits:
CSWAP = [[1,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0], [0, 1,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0], [0, 0, 1,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0], [0, 0, 0, 1, 0, 0, 0, 0], [0, 0, 0, 0, 1, 0, 0, 0], [0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 1, 0], [0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 1, 0, 0], [0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 1]]
- Parameters
control – The control qubit.
target_1 – The first target qubit.
target_2 – The second target qubit. The two target states are swapped if the control is in the
|1>
state.
- pyquil.gates.CZ(control: Union[pyquil.quilatom.Qubit, pyquil.quilatom.QubitPlaceholder, pyquil.quilatom.FormalArgument, int], target: Union[pyquil.quilatom.Qubit, pyquil.quilatom.QubitPlaceholder, pyquil.quilatom.FormalArgument, int]) pyquil.quilbase.Gate [source]¶
Produces a controlled-Z gate:
CZ = [[1, 0, 0, 0], [0, 1, 0, 0], [0, 0, 1, 0], [0, 0, 0, -1]]
This gate applies to two qubit arguments to produce the controlled-Z gate instruction.
- Parameters
control – The control qubit.
target – The target qubit. The target qubit has an Z-gate applied to it if the control qubit is in the excited state.
- Returns
A Gate object.

- pyquil.gates.DELAY(*args) Union[pyquil.quilbase.DelayFrames, pyquil.quilbase.DelayQubits] [source]¶
Produce a DELAY instruction.
Note: There are two variants of DELAY. One applies to specific frames on some qubit, e.g. DELAY 0 “rf” “ff” 1.0 delays the “rf” and “ff” frames on 0. It is also possible to delay all frames on some qubits, e.g. DELAY 0 1 2 1.0.
- Parameters
args – A list of delay targets, ending with a duration.
- Returns
A DelayFrames or DelayQubits instance.

- pyquil.gates.I(qubit: Union[pyquil.quilatom.Qubit, pyquil.quilatom.QubitPlaceholder, pyquil.quilatom.FormalArgument, int]) pyquil.quilbase.Gate [source]¶
Produces the I identity gate:
I = [1, 0] [0, 1]
This gate is a single qubit identity gate. Note that this gate is different that the NOP instruction as noise channels are typically still applied during the duration of identity gates. Identities will also block parallelization like any other gate.
- Parameters
qubit – The qubit apply the gate to.
- Returns
A Gate object.

- pyquil.gates.ISWAP(q1: Union[pyquil.quilatom.Qubit, pyquil.quilatom.QubitPlaceholder, pyquil.quilatom.FormalArgument, int], q2: Union[pyquil.quilatom.Qubit, pyquil.quilatom.QubitPlaceholder, pyquil.quilatom.FormalArgument, int]) pyquil.quilbase.Gate [source]¶
Produces an ISWAP gate:
ISWAP = [[1, 0, 0, 0], [0, 0, 1j, 0], [0, 1j, 0, 0], [0, 0, 0, 1]]
This gate swaps the state of two qubits, applying a -i phase to q1 when it is in the 1 state and a -i phase to q2 when it is in the 0 state.
- Parameters
q1 – Qubit 1.
q2 – Qubit 2.
- Returns
A Gate object.

- pyquil.gates.RX(angle: Union[pyquil.quilatom.Expression, pyquil.quilatom.MemoryReference, numpy.int64, int, float, complex], qubit: Union[pyquil.quilatom.Qubit, pyquil.quilatom.QubitPlaceholder, pyquil.quilatom.FormalArgument, int]) pyquil.quilbase.Gate [source]¶
Produces the RX gate:
RX(phi) = [[cos(phi / 2), -1j * sin(phi / 2)], [-1j * sin(phi / 2), cos(phi / 2)]]
This gate is a single qubit X-rotation.
- Parameters
angle – The angle to rotate around the x-axis on the bloch sphere.
qubit – The qubit apply the gate to.
- Returns
A Gate object.
- pyquil.gates.RY(angle: Union[pyquil.quilatom.Expression, pyquil.quilatom.MemoryReference, numpy.int64, int, float, complex], qubit: Union[pyquil.quilatom.Qubit, pyquil.quilatom.QubitPlaceholder, pyquil.quilatom.FormalArgument, int]) pyquil.quilbase.Gate [source]¶
Produces the RY gate:
RY(phi) = [[cos(phi / 2), -sin(phi / 2)], [sin(phi / 2), cos(phi / 2)]]
This gate is a single qubit Y-rotation.
- Parameters
angle – The angle to rotate around the y-axis on the bloch sphere.
qubit – The qubit apply the gate to.
- Returns
A Gate object.
- pyquil.gates.RZ(angle: Union[pyquil.quilatom.Expression, pyquil.quilatom.MemoryReference, numpy.int64, int, float, complex], qubit: Union[pyquil.quilatom.Qubit, pyquil.quilatom.QubitPlaceholder, pyquil.quilatom.FormalArgument, int]) pyquil.quilbase.Gate [source]¶
Produces the RZ gate:
RZ(phi) = [[cos(phi / 2) - 1j * sin(phi / 2), 0] [0, cos(phi / 2) + 1j * sin(phi / 2)]]
This gate is a single qubit Z-rotation.
- Parameters
angle – The angle to rotate around the z-axis on the bloch sphere.
qubit – The qubit apply the gate to.
- Returns
A Gate object.
